Context
  • Working Under the overall supervision of the Head of Sub Office (Maiduguri), and direct supervision of the Programme Manager (Shelter), the successful candidate will be responsible for designing, planning, carrying out and presenting the rental subsidy / shelter needs assessments in host community situations in various locations of North East Nigeria particularly in Borno States.
Core Functions / Responsibilities
  • Monitor the quality of the data collected and support the identification of gaps and possible response activities and indicators.
  • Analyze the data from assessments, interviews, discussions and evaluations, draft related dashboards and reports, present the findings.
  • Produce a final report that include all main sections: introduction, methodology, results and recommendation with narrative analysis of the results.
  • Ensures that the Program Manager is informed of all issues, developments, and changes related to needs assessment process.
  • Identify the gaps related to the shelter response in the host community situations and provide recommendations for strategic planning.
  • Coordinate with all relevant units within the organization, such as Livelihoods, CCCM and WASH.
  • Conduct visits to the field whenever it is necessary.
  • Perform such other duties as may be assigned.
  • Design, plan and conduct needs assessments related to shelter response (including shelter conditions, status of households, housing typologies, tenure arrangements / type of agreement with owners, rental arrangements, etc) in various locations within the host communities at state level, LGA level and ward level (mainly Borno state).
  • Design, plan and conduct KII’s, FGD’s with host communities and IDPs living within the host community at state level, LGA level and ward level (mainly Borno state).
  • Train enumerators to ensure the best quality for data collection and production of a sufficient baseline.
  • Clean and merge the data on regular basis ensuring that all observations are uniquely identified and reported data is internally consistent.
Specific deliverables:
  • By end of first month: Progress report including assessment methodology and finalized tool - By end of second month / end of assignment: Final report including findings and recommendations, summary presentation to IOM Nigeria’s relevant units
